AD05 BWG is a 2005 Volkswagen Sharan in Grey with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 25 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76%.
Across all 2005 Volkswagen Sharan models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.4% with a typical mileage of 102,609 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Sharan f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 37,436 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AD05 BWG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Sharan typ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 21 years old, this Volkswagen Sharan is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
